Dylan Thuras, born in Minneapolis, Minnesota, is the co-founder and creative director of Atlas Obscura, the co-author of the Atlas Obscura book, and the host of the AO Youtube series 100 Wonders. He and his co-founder started Atlas Obscura because they felt that the world was a huge, bizarre, vast place filled with astounding stuff. Dylan is now a father of two and host of the Atlas Obscura podcast. | Guest | |
